This book is a definite guide for scholars, designers, and educators who refuse to settle for "good enough." Bridging theory and real-world application, it examines how instructional systems are not only created—but systematically studied, refined, and strengthened through evidence-based inquiry.
it’s a manual for innovation that delivers a deep dive into the three pillars of instructional excellence:
Theory: Explore the fundamental concepts that control how humans learn and how these theories are translated into functional design models.
Practice: Move beyond the classroom with real-world case studies and realistic strategies for creating high-impact learning tools.
Process Improvement: Learn how to leverage data-driven research to improve your workflow, reduce design obstacles, and make each learning intervention more effective than the last.
Why This Book?
Whether you're a graduate student learning the ADDIE model or a CLO wanting to maximize your team's performance, this book offers techniques to validate your designs using empirical evidence to develop scalable systems that can adapt to various learning settings.
